Italy: Disappointing results for scheme to boost supplementary pensions

It appears that a plan to encourage employees to transfer their severance pay entitlement into supplementary pension funds has so far not had the desired effects.

Under Italian law, employers must set aside around 8% of their employees' wages and pay the accrued amount to them as a lump-sum severance payment – the "end-of-service" allowance (Trattamento di fine rapporto, Tfr) – at the end of the employment relationship.
